Yes, I think NSF's can be attached out to SAFSA (whatever sport) after their BMT, though not on a permanent basis - i.e. they have an initial NS unit &, I believe, vocation as well.
Their football team plays in the National Football League, Division 2. Not sure about the formal arrangements with the SAFFC club.
Google for the SAFSA Secretariat address & contact them to see if they conduct trials, etc.

Sportsmen are posted officially to whichever units but are attached out to whichever organisation to train and play. bear in mind that this normally happens for downgraded personnel, very rarely do you have a PES A/B person in an Active unit being attached out for long periods (have heard of cases where some active personnel have been attached out for 1-2mths to play polo for their formation)
if your soccer skills are exceptionally good and don't get accepted in SAFFC, you can always play for your formation and all that kind of thing. not attached out full time, but still get to FO at 2pm to train etc. etc.
